[03 Nov 2013] At least 70 Rohingyas including women & kids on board of sunken boat - English

More tragedy for one of the most persecuted communities in the world. A boat full of Rohingya Muslims breaks apart in the Bay of Bengal off the western coast of Myanmar. Aid workers say so far only eight have survived and dozens more are missing. They were among at least 70 Rohingyas including women, children and babies who were on board the boat that left Myanmar for Bangladesh. The United Nation is warning about several reports of boat drowning off the coasts of Myanmar. According to the UN human rights commission, at least 15-hundred people left their homes in the restive Rakhine state last week alone. Myanmar has been plagued by sectarian tensions for years. Buddhists\' violence against Rohingya\'s community has left hundreds of Muslims dead in addition to over 250-thousand people displaced.

[05 Dec 2013] Thai immigration officials sold Rohingyas to human traffickers - English

A new investigation indicates that immigration officials in Thailand have sold hundreds of Rohingya Muslims to human traffickers. The report says Myanmar\'s Rohingyas who fled oppression in their home country, have been secretly transported across southern Thailand. They were held hostage for ransom in a series of heavily-guarded camps near Thailand\'s border with Malaysia. Detainees who couldn\'t pay ransom have been sold to some shipping companies and farms. Some survivors who were interviewed by reporters said a number of detainees were killed by traffickers or died from dehydration or diseases. Thailand\'s second-highest-ranking policeman has also admitted that Thai officials might have profited from the smuggling because that meant removing the refugees from detention centers in Thailand.
